Comprehending the Belgian Driving License System

Belgium follows a structured approach to releasing driving licenses, which are governed by European Union (EU) policies. The Belgian driving license is divided into a number of classifications depending upon the kind of automobile one prepares to drive. The most common types consist of:

License CategoryCar TypeMinimum AgeExamples
BGuest automobiles (up to 3,500 kg)18Many personal cars and trucks
CTrucks (over 3,500 kg)21Lorries, delivery van
DBuses (more than 9 travelers)24City buses, coaches
BEMix automobile with a trailer18Vehicle + trailer over 750 kg
ABikes (over 125cc)20Motorcycles

Step-by-Step Guide to Obtaining Your Driving License in Belgium

Action 1: Determine Your Eligibility

Before you start the application procedure, inspect the eligibility requirements:

  • Age: Must be 18 or older for a classification B license.
  • Residency: You need to be a homeowner of Belgium or possess a legitimate long-lasting visa.
  • Health: You may require to undergo a medical evaluation to guarantee physical fitness to drive.

Action 2: Pass a Theory Exam

To begin your journey towards obtaining a driving license:

  1. Enroll in a Driving School: It is advised to register in a recognized driving school, although self-study is likewise an option.
  2. Prepare for the Theory Test: Study the highway code and driving regulations. Practice tests are offered online for preparation.
  3. Take the Theory Exam: Schedule and take the theory test, which includes multiple-choice concerns.

Action 3: Obtain a Learner's Permit

Upon passing the theory exam, you will receive a student's authorization (temporary driving license) that permits you to practice driving.

  • Practice Duration: A student's permit is usually legitimate for 18 months.
  • Accompaniment: When driving, you should be accompanied by a licensed chauffeur with at least 8 years of experience.

Step 4: Complete Driving Lessons

Register in practical driving lessons to get hands-on experience. The majority of driving schools offer bundles that consist of a set number of lessons and may even offer mock driving tests.

Step 5: Pass the Practical Driving Test

Once you feel great in your driving capabilities, you can arrange the practical driving test. The procedure consists of:

  1. Test Preparation: Ensure you recognize with the lorry and the test path.
  2. Take the Test: The inspector will assess your driving skills, consisting of parking, highway merging, and roadway signs comprehension.

Action 6: Apply for Your Driving License

Upon passing the practical test, you can now look for your official driving license. The steps are:

  1. Gather Required Documents: These generally consist of:
  • Valid recognition
  • Evidence of residence
  • Pass certificates for both theory and dry runs
  • Medical certificate, if relevant
  1. Submit Application: Visit the regional commune or licensing authority to submit your application.
  2. Pay Fees: There are costs related to the application procedure, generally around EUR25-EUR50 depending on the area.

Action 7: Receive Your Driving License

After processing, which may take a couple of weeks, you will receive your Belgian driving license.

Essential Points to Remember

  • License Validity: The Belgian driving license is valid for 10 years and needs renewal thereafter.
  • Foreign Licenses: If you hold a valid foreign driving license, you might exchange it for a Belgian license under certain conditions.
  • Points System: Belgium operates a points system for driving offenses, which can cause penalties or license suspension.
